Key Innovations: Elevating Player Engagement with Unique Mechanics
Modern slot games differentiate themselves through features like:
- Dynamic Bonus Rounds: Randomly triggered mini-games that offer substantial payouts or free spins.
- Winning Patterns Beyond Lines: Cluster-based wins or symbol-matching mechanics that deviate from traditional paylines.
- Progressive Features: Collectible tokens or accumulating multipliers that reward persistent gameplay.
